[vlc-devel] [PATCH 17/20] ADD for module configs: list of slave config options
Rémi Denis-Courmont
rem at videolan.org
Tue Apr 21 09:37:56 CEST 2009
Le mardi 21 avril 2009, basos g a écrit :
> I understand that this would be more convenient when declaring
> masters. And i could provide a modified implementation for the plugin
> interface (e.g. provide a master with the apropriate call to a macro
> at the declaration of the slave plugin, rather a list of slaves at
> the declaration of a master plugin). But the underlying structure
> would still be a list of slaves stored at the master configuration.
> This is needed as it will provide faster execution ( bear in mind
> that slaves seeking could be triggered by UI events and should
> respond fast enough). Also the implementation for this is already
> defined.
A single slaves list per master will become a terrible mess if we ever
need to ifdef parts of it.
In fact, I really don't like the way you put all the logic in the UI.
That sort of stuff belongs in the core, hidden. I haven't been cleaning
the module and configuration for two years for others to come and
entangle it again 6 months later.
--
Rémi Denis-Courmont
http://www.remlab.net/
More information about the vlc-devel
mailing list